A construction worker is dead following an accident at a job site in St. Petersburg. Authorities say 53-year-old John Winchester was driving a roller on top of a sand berm on Thursday afternoon when it slipped and rolled on top of him. Sgt. Elizabeth Brady of the Pinellas County Sheriff's Office told the Tampa Bay Times Winchester was pinned under the machine. Co-workers used other pieces of equipment to free him. But Winchester was pronounced dead at the scene. The roller was being used to pack the sand on the berm. Winchester worked for Woodruff & Sons of Bradenton. The company had been hired by the Southwest Florida Water Management District to build the berm. An investigation is underway. Source : Construction worker killed in St. Petersburg
